Specs :
Case & PSU - Supermicro CSE-732i-500B
Motherboard - Supermicro H8DMi-2
CPU's - 2x AMD Opteron - 2419
Heatsinks - 2x Dynatron A86g - Noctua NF-A6x25 FLX
Memory - 6GB DDR2 REG ECC
Hard Drive - Samsung Spinpoint 500GB
Network Adapter - TP-LINK TL-WN751ND
Operating System - Ubuntu

I was accually suprised at how much they tried to silence this case, the fan screws are rubber, there are these thick rubber parts on the edges of the cdrom and HDD cage, 4pin pwm san ace in the rear that is actually really quiet even at full speed.

not sure about PSU maker seems like a decent PSU with a single 120mm fan instead of silly single or dual 80mm.

Connectors
-1x 24pin
-1x 8pin EPS
-1x 4+4pin EPS
-6x Sata
-2x Floppy pwr
-6x Molex
-1x 6+2pin PCIEXPRESS
-1x 6pin PCIEXPRESS

So, overall id say that this case is pretty awesome and for the price really cant be beat, I think its one of the cheapest cases that fits e-atx and the space savings of a midtower over a full tower when im not adding anthing other than one HDD is pretty awesome. all put together the powersupply is the loudest part by far, but id say is just a little louder than the noctua's that were put into it (60mm noctua).

Airflow is pretty good I was thinking about adding the second fan to it but really see so reason why I should do so as with just the rear fan and the PSU it pulls quite a bit of air thru the front of the case.
